Vai ai contenuti
Code
Web & Seo
Un giorno Smokey il topolino decise di mostrare alla Signora Lucertola (Lucy) una nuova sezione del suo portfolio.
Con il suo solito entusiasmo, Smokey iniziò a spiegare:

Benvenuti nella mia pagina dei progetti di coding

"Qui", indicando lo schermo del suo computer, "troverai una raccolta delle sperimentazioni più recenti con i linguaggi di programmazione Python, PHP, JavaScript, e linguaggi grafici HTML, CSS. Ogni progetto rappresenta un passo avanti nel mio percorso di apprendimento e nella mia passione per lo sviluppo web".

Smokey scorreva tra i vari progetti, spiegando con entusiasmo: "Ho incluso (e continuerò ad arricchire questa pagina) con una varietà di script e applicazioni che illustrano diverse tecniche e funzionalità. Dai semplici script di automazione ai complessi sistemi interattivi, ogni progetto mostra qualcosa di nuovo e interessante".
Video i-frame
Lucy osservava affascinata mentre Smokey continuava: "Navigando tra i progetti, troverai descrizioni dettagliate e il codice sorgente completo. Spero che queste risorse possano essere di ispirazione o utilità per i tuoi stessi progetti".

Smokey aggiunse, con un sorriso amichevole: "Sentiti libera di esplorare, utilizzare e modificare il codice secondo le tue necessità. La condivisione della conoscenza è una delle cose che amo di più dello sviluppo web".

E così, grazie alla guida di Smokey, Lucy scoprì un mondo di possibilità nella programmazione web, pronta a esplorare e imparare dai progetti del suo amico topolino.

#Script-63: visualizzatore modelli 3D

Utilizzeremo la libreria JavaScript chiamata "Three.js" per visualizzare un modello 3D interattivo su una pagina HTML.
Ho implementato in sequenza:
  1. Includo la libreria Three.js e GLTFLoader direttamente dal CDN nella pagina HTML ;
  2. Creo una scena, una camera e un renderer;
  3. Aggiungo una luce ambientale;
  4. Posiziono la camera e aggiungo i controlli orbitanti;
  5. Setto gli assi di visione e lo zoom sul progetto;
  6. Creo la funzione di animazione;
  7. Gestisco il ridimensionamento della finestra.

NB: Il codice è ancora in fase di definizione.


3D model viewer

3D model viewer

#Script-58: generare QR-code personalizzabile

Utilizzeremo la libreria JavaScript "qrcodejs", in più tramite un canvas sarà possibile aggiungere un logo o un'immagine al centro del QR code.
Il risultato si aprirà in una nuova finestra del browser (non una finestra popup) per ovviare alle dimensioni della finestra a seconda del dispositivo uttilizzato.
Ecco il risultato:

Generatore di QR-code Personalizzabile

Generatore di QR-code Personalizzabile















#Script-56: Directory Lister

Di seguito il risultato a schermo del contenuto di una cartella al'interno del server pubblico.
NB - I file elencati nello script hanno valenza puramente esemplificativa.
Visualizzazione File e Cartelle

Elenco file e cartelle nella directory PUBLIC

#Script-42: CownDown a una data specifica

CownDown da ora alla data del 17 Novembre 2024 alle ore 20:00
Countdown

#Script-38: Mappe online in XML

Tramite file XLM per creare KLM per Google Maps, alcune mappe online dettagliate di varie informazioni:
grigioscuro.com © 2009 - All Rights Reserved
Torna ai contenuti
grigioscuro WhatsApp Icon